When repaying student loan obligations, prioritize them by interest rate. The highest rate loan should be paid first. Then utilize the extra cash to pay off the other loans. You don’t risk penalty by paying the loans back faster.

Perkins and Stafford are some of the best federal student loans. They are the safest and most economical. It ends up being a very good deal, because the federal government ends up paying the interest while you attend school. Perkins loan interest rates are at 5 percent. The subsidized Stafford loan has an interest rate that does not exceed 6.8%.

Defaulting on a loan is not freedom from repaying it. There are ways that the government can collect the money against your wishes. For example, they can claim a little of a tax return or even a Social Security payment. They can also claim up to fifteen percent of your income that is disposable. This can become financially devastating.
